hello and thank you for the feedback, I use gearboxes 1: 3 or 1: 4 with Krick Max Power 400 motors, 8ohm Visaton 8 and 10 speakers according to the place in the tank, otherwise I use adequate materials in the production, which is made of metal, metal, preferably brass, copper, sheet metal from thinners and the like
